Why Study in the UK?
Before diving into the process, let’s understand why the UK is one of the top destinations for Indian students.
The UK is home to prestigious institutions like University of Oxford and University of Manchester. Degrees from UK universities are globally recognized and respected by employers worldwide.
Key benefits include:
- 1-year Master’s programs (saving time and money)
- 2-year Post-Study Work Visa (Graduate Route)
- Multicultural environment
- Strong career prospects
- High-quality education system

Step 1: Choose the Right Course & University
The first and most important step in this Step-by-Step Guide to Study in the UK for Indian Students is course selection.
Ask yourself:
- What career do I want in the future?
- Does this course match my academic background?
- What are the job opportunities after graduation?
Popular courses among Indian students include:
- Business & Management
- Data Science & IT
- Engineering
- Healthcare & Nursing
- Law
- Finance
Choosing the right university depends on ranking, location, tuition fees, and entry requirements.

Step 2: Check Eligibility Requirements
Every university has its own entry criteria, but generally, you will need:
- Academic transcripts (10th, 12th, Graduation)
- English proficiency test (IELTS/PTE)
- Statement of Purpose (SOP)
- Letters of Recommendation (LOR)
- Passport
For most UK universities:
- IELTS requirement: 6.0 – 7.0 bands
- Minimum academic score: 60%+ (varies by university)
Understanding eligibility early helps avoid rejection.
Step 3: Prepare Required Documents
Documentation is a critical part of your application.
Important documents include:
- Academic certificates
- Updated CV
- Passport copy
- SOP (well-written and personalized)
- Financial documents
Your SOP should clearly explain:
- Why you chose the UK
- Why this course?
- Your career plans
- Why this university?
A strong SOP increases your admission chances significantly.
Step 4: Apply to UK Universities
Applications are usually submitted online through university portals.
For undergraduate programs, applications are made via UCAS. For postgraduate programs, you apply directly through the university website.
Make sure you:
- Apply before deadlines
- Double-check all documents
- Pay the application fee (if applicable)
Once selected, you will receive an Offer Letter (Conditional or Unconditional).
Step 5: Receive CAS Letter
After accepting your offer and paying the tuition deposit, the university will issue a CAS (Confirmation of Acceptance for Studies) letter.
This document is essential for your UK student visa application.
The CAS contains:
- Course details
- Tuition fee information
- University sponsor license number
Without CAS, you cannot apply for a visa.
Step 6: Apply for UK Student Visa
This is one of the most important stages in the Step-by-Step Guide to Study in the UK for Indian Students.
Indian students must apply for a UK Student Visa (Tier 4).
Documents required:
- CAS letter
- Passport
- Financial proof (tuition + living expenses)
- IELTS scorecard
- TB test report
You also need to pay:
- Visa application fee
- Immigration Health Surcharge (IHS)
Visa processing time is generally 3–4 weeks
Step 7: Prepare Financial Requirements
Financial planning is crucial.
You must show proof of funds covering:
- First-year tuition fees
- Living expenses (£1,334 per month for London, £1,023 per month outside London for 9 months)
Funds must be maintained in your account for at least 28 consecutive days before applying for a visa.
Students can apply for:
- Education loans
- Scholarships
- University bursaries
Step 8: Plan Accommodation & Travel
After receiving your visa:
- Book flight tickets
- Arrange accommodation (University hostel or private housing)
- Attend pre-departure orientation
Many universities offer guaranteed accommodation if applied early.
Step 9: Part-Time Work Opportunities
International students in the UK can work:
- 20 hours per week during term
- Full-time during holidays
This helps manage living expenses and gain work experience.
Step 10: Post-Study Work Visa (Graduate Route)
One of the biggest advantages of studying in the UK is the Graduate Route Visa.
After completing your degree, you can stay:
- 2 years (Bachelor’s or Master’s)
- 3 years (PhD)
This allows you to work full-time and gain international experience.
